According to data from the China Passenger Car Association (CPCA), in December 2025, a total of 28 SUV models surpassed 10,000 units in retail sales nationwide in the narrow-definition passenger vehicle segment. The Tesla Model Y topped the chart with sales of 65,874 units, demonstrating strong competitiveness. Among domestic brands, models such as the Xiaomi YU7, Ti 7, and Aito M7 saw robust sales, while joint-venture models like the Corolla Cross, Tiguan L, and Frontlander also maintained steady performance. New-energy vehicles are increasingly favored by modern consumers, with the Model Y and Xiaomi YU7 leading their segment, although traditional internal combustion engine vehicles still hold a notable market share. Overall, "internet-famous" SUVs combining intelligence and electrification are driving current consumer trends.
